The enrollment cutoff numbers are as follows:
UIL CONFERENCE CUTOFF NUMBERS
Fall 2014 – Spring 2016
2014-2015 & 2015-2016
6A 2100 & up
5A 1060-2099
4A 465-1059
3A 220-464
2A 105-219
1A 104.9 and below

There are 32 districts in each class. (2a-6a). 1a is 6man. Four teams from each district make the playoffs. Out of those four the two with the biggest student population go d1 and the two smaller go d2. Because of this There have been several teams win state in d2 that had more kids then the d1 champ and one year you could be d1 then the next d2
